Understanding 0499 070 875

The phone number 0499 070 875 / 0499070875 has recently been reported by users as a scam, specifically targeting individuals with fraudulent messages about redeeming Telstra points. It's crucial to stay informed about such scams, especially when they impersonate established companies like Telstra.

Classification of the Number

Based on user reports, 0499 070 875 / 0499070875 falls into the category of scam. Individuals have noted receiving text messages claiming they are entitled to redeem points with Telstra, prompting concerns over the legitimacy of this communication.

Details of the Scam

This particular scam uses the guise of a well-known telecommunications provider to lure unsuspecting users. Reports indicate that these messages are designed to create a sense of urgency, urging recipients to act quickly to redeem points they may never have accrued. It is particularly alarming to note that users who do not utilise Telstra services have received these messages, which only amplifies the suspicion surrounding this number.

How to Handle Calls or Messages from 0499 070 875

  • Do Not Respond: If you receive a message or call from this number, it is advisable not to engage with it. Responding may confirm your contact details and open the door to more scam attempts.
  • Report the Scam: You can report this number to the Australian Competition and Consumer Commission (ACCC) or the relevant consumer protection agency in your state.
  • Utilise Reverse Phone Lookup: If you're uncertain about whether a number is legitimate, consider using services like Reverseau for a quick verification. A reverse phone lookup can provide details about who called you in Australia.
  • Stay Informed: Regularly review updates on common scams in Australia to better protect yourself from potential fraud.

In summary, 0499 070 875 / 0499070875 is a scam number aimed at deceiving consumers into believing they have points with Telstra. Always approach unsolicited communications with caution, and remember that if something seems too good to be true, it probably is.
